I have been to Sorella’s a couple of times in the past and after eating there again last night I decided it’s time to write a review. Not that this place is undiscovered — in fact it’s crazy-busy on weekend nights, and they don’t take reservations. Amazingly, we got a table within 10 minutes, and despite the fact that the place was packed, we got excellent and fast service, and a fantastic meal. On top of that, they have a guitar/piano duo playing on Friday evenings that is stellar. The musicians were having fun playing a mix of blues, R&B, and old classic rock tunes, and it was a great scene. However, if you want to hear the music, ask for a table in the back room, since the main room is so noisy you can’t hear anything in there. Later in the evening, as the crowds thinned, we had another glass of wine and moved to the back room, and enjoyed some great music. So it was really dinner and a show for the price of a dinner! Oh, about the dinner… Sorella’s is no run-of-the-mill Italian place. For starters we had the mixed green salad. At this place they don’t ask you what kind of dressing you want, and then glop on something from a bottle. No, the lovely mixed baby greens come with a house dressing that is an inscrutably mysterious elixir. I wish I could figure out what’s in their dressing so I could make it at home. Even though they gave us chunks of fresh parmesan for our bread, I used my bread to wipe up every drop of that salad dressing. For main courses, they have the best eggplant parmesan I’ve ever tasted. I swear I’m going to have cravings for that dish. The sauce is incredible, and the balance of cheese, eggplant, and sauce is perfect. We also got their special risotto — saffron with shrimp and scallops. The seafood was super-fresh and perfectly cooked, and the vegetables were also firm and not overcooked. Also, don’t skip their desserts — we had a lovely chocolate tartufo. Highly recommended!
